Fair enough, bottle_head9, I apologize. I'm not a flask collector, but I knew it was going to be worth quite a bit more than $150. It would appear it is going to go for far more than my first estimate. It just seemed like the numbers I was seeing offered were patently too low. You obviously offered what you thought it was worth. Fair enough. Now we'll let the market dictate what it is worth (more than most of us would pay, I suspect).

Common mold, but going to be WAY pushed up by the pontil and awesome color. Towhead, thanks for telling us about it. Always fun to watch a GOOD bottle run the ebay route. Especially when I'm not trying to buy it.
